Topaz ReMask vs. CS5 Intelligent Selection
Sep 14, 2010
|
I'm new to CS5 and to the process of making intricate selections. I've played with Topaz ReMask 2 with mixed results some being easy and amazing and other attempts being long frustrating lost causes. In trying to get a handle on new features in CS5 I've jumped around watching web videos one of which demonstrated the new CS5 intelligent selection using a woman's wispy hair as an example. It sure made it look easy. But, I haven't tried it yet for a similar subject and my little bit of dabbling hasn't helped my confidence. I know it will take time to learn, but I wonder what you extraction gurus think of the new CS5 process and if you can offer tips for us beginners?
I also wonder if Topaz's delay releasing the long promised ReMask improvements has something to do with CS5's new feature?
